MV Agusta 1958 CSTL  175cc 1 cyl OHC  Frame # 920087   Engine # 401402

After WWII the Agusta family was no longer allowed to manufacture airplanes.
It was decided to take up the   production  of motorcycles and in  1946 they brought out the “98”, a two stroke runabout.
That same year a 98 Sport won the first race MV Agusta entered.
This started  the company on a competition path that would result in 37 world championships.
Six years later at the 1952 Milan Show, Agusta pulled the wraps off the 175 CST.
This was  a single overhead camshaft design with a 4-speed gearbox and a chain-driven single overhead camshaft valve train.
It was also the first MV four-stroke to go into series production and would go on to greater glory on the racetrack.
The engine was  rated at 8 HP.
Also released the same year was a version equipped with 19-inch wheels and a long seat which we present here as a 1958 example.
Approximately 6,000 examples were built over the motorcycle’s three-year production run.
It is an important model in MV’s history.
Technical Specification:
Cylinders 1 cyl  4-stroke
Displacement: 172,3 cc
Power / rpm: 8 HP / 5,200
Carburettor: 18 mm carburettor
Lubrication: wet sump
Clutch: wet multiple plate clutch
Gearbox: 4 speeds
Frame: double tubular and pressed steel frame
Front brake: 180 mm drum
Rear brake: 150 mm drum
Front and rear tire: 3.50 x19”
Tank: 14 litres
